|
本帖最后由 小崽不是叔 于 2011-4-6 13:55 编辑 1、编程求1+2+3+4+…+100的和,并输出结果。
2、使用数组,从键盘输入10个数,求出其中最小的数并与最后一个数组元素的值进行交换。
3、定义函数parity判断给定整数的奇偶性,如果是偶数则返回1,否则返回0,函数返回值类型是int。定义函数main(),输入正整数n,要求调用函数判断该数的奇偶性,并输出判断结果 
1、编程求1+2+3+4+…+100的和,并输出结果。
#include "stdio.h"
int main()
{
int n=100,sum=0,
i=1;
while (i<=n)
{
sum+=i;
i++;
}
printf("sum=%d",sum);
}
getch();
2、使用数组,从键盘输入10个数,求出其中最小的数并与最后一个数组元素的值进行交换。
#include<stdio.h>
int main(void)
{
int a[10],i,min,b;
printf("input 10 integers:");
for(i=0;i<10;i++)
scanf("%d",&a); min=0;
for(i=1;i<10;i++)
if(a<a[min])
min=i;
b=a[min];
a[min]=a[9];
a[9]=b;
for(i=0;i<10;i++)
printf("%d ",a);}
getch();3、定义函数parity判断给定整数的奇偶性,如果是偶数则返回1,否则返回0,函数返回值类型是int。定义函数main(),输入正整数n,要求调用函数判断该数的奇偶性,并输出判断结果
#include<stdio.h>
int parity(int n)
{
if(n%2==0)
printf("n为偶数.");
else
printf("n为奇数.");
return 0;
}
int main(){
int n;
scanf("%d",&n); parity(n);
}
getch(); |
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有帐号?注册
x
|